About us
SageWell is a community-based, non-profit organization dedicated to supporting adults aged 55+ across Nova Scotia to live healthy, connected, and independent lives. With a welcoming, no-membership approach, SageWell offers accessible, low-cost (and often free) programs designed to meet the physical, social, and emotional needs of older adults—whether they attend in person or from home.
At its core, SageWell creates opportunities for connection and belonging. Through a wide range of programs—including exercise classes, pickleball, social groups, educational workshops, technology training, and special events—participants are encouraged to stay active, learn new skills, and build meaningful relationships. Programs are designed to be inclusive and adaptable, ensuring that individuals of all abilities and backgrounds feel comfortable participating.
Beyond programming, SageWell plays a vital role in reducing isolation and supporting overall well-being. Initiatives such as food delivery programs, technology support, safety education, and caregiver-focused programming help remove barriers that many older adults face. By combining practical supports with social engagement, SageWell helps individuals maintain independence while feeling valued and connected within their community.
With over 30 years of impact and a growing presence in both urban and rural communities, SageWell continues to evolve—expanding its reach, strengthening partnerships, and responding to the changing needs of older adults. Through its work, SageWell is building stronger, more inclusive communities where aging is supported, celebrated, and lived well.
